Comprehensive Definitions & Senses

2 senses
As noun
  1. 1

    A picture or design created using paint on a surface such as canvas, wood, or paper.

    "The museum houses a priceless collection of Renaissance paintings."
  2. 2

    The action or skill of applying paint to a surface.

    "Oil painting requires patience and a deep understanding of light and shadow."

Linguistic Origin & Historical Etymology

Derived from the verb 'paint', originating from Old French 'peindre' (to paint), which traces back to the Latin 'pingere' (to embroider, paint, depict). The suffix '-ing' was added in Middle English to denote the resulting action, craft, or physical object produced.
